What gauge wire used for a fifteen amp breaker?

AWG # 14 copper.


What gauge wire and amp breaker do you use on a stove dryer and hot water heater?

For a stove, use a 8 or 6 gauge wire with a 40 to 50 amp breaker. For a dryer, use a 10 or 8 gauge wire with a 30 amp breaker. For a hot water heater, use a 10 or 8 gauge wire with a 30 or 40 amp breaker. Be sure to consult local electrical codes and guidelines for specific requirements.

What gauge wire should be used for a 30 amp breaker?

For a 30 amp breaker, a 10-gauge wire should be used.


What gauge wire should be used for a 60 amp breaker?

For a 60 amp breaker, a 6-gauge wire should be used.


What is the recommended wire size for a 20 amp breaker?

The recommended wire size for a 20 amp breaker is typically 12-gauge wire.
